Is it too late to fix the problem, at least to some extent? Probably not... you have to understand that the 16 year streak and namely the attitude of many G riz fans toward Bobcat fans during the streak contributed to the build up of a LOT of bitterness from our side towards yours. If the rivalry evens out as seems to be happening, over time the bitterness will begin to subside and the two fan groups should get along better as the product of a competitive rivalry. Of course, this is all IMO. And, there will always be people who will take things too far. We just have to try and minimize the the size of this group.[/quote]

Everything that has been said on this string has been great to see. The few things that contribute most to the semi-hatred is the streak and the college students who don't care about the game. I will admit the streak put a lot of fire in Cat fans especially those who lived in NW Montana, but as the tide has shifted a little the Cat fans have become more level headed. If the rivalry is competitive for a while I think that we will see a general shift in the attitudes of both sides to where the rivalry is more jovial. The second issue I don't think will ever been taken care of until every MSU home game is nearly sold out. As a huge sports fan and current student at MSU nothing burns me more than to go to every game cheer for the Bobcats win or lose and then watch my peers talk terribly about the team until Cat/Griz rolls around and they jump on the bandwagon. I know many students who went through the line multiple times to score tickets for Cat/Griz just so they could get completely loaded with their buddies and go make asses of themselves. I am not saying I am better than them, I started tailgating at 10:00am, but I was there to support the Cats. The problem is, most of the multiple ticket holders have never been to any other Cat game in their lives. I believe it is people/students like this that cause the most trouble with the opponents. Give me a break, when you have to ask me who #10 is don't expect to get a friendly reply from me. Does anyone else have a problem with students/others coming to only the Cat/Griz game? or am I just way too anti-bandwagon?
